The cheapest way to get from San Jose to Grand Forks is to Caltrain and fly which costs $140 - $550 and takes 7h 45m.
The fastest way to get from San Jose to Grand Forks is to fly which takes 7h 44m and costs $150 - $650.
The distance between San Jose and Grand Forks is 1463 miles. The road distance is 1857.6 miles.
The best way to get from San Jose to Grand Forks without a car is to train and bus which takes 2 days 10h and costs $800 - $1,700.
It takes approximately 7h 44m to get from San Jose to Grand Forks, including transfers.
Grand Forks is 2h ahead of San Jose. It is currently 5:08 AM in San Jose and 7:08 AM in Grand Forks.
Yes, the driving distance between San Jose to Grand Forks is 1858 miles. It takes approximately 29h 45m to drive from San Jose to Grand Forks.
